About iBuyFlowers

iBuyFlowers was founded in 2016 by Wilfred de Wit, a Dutch lily grower's son with deep roots in the floral industry, is a passionate, growing online marketplace revolutionizing the flower industry. We empower US customers to order the freshest quality flowers 24/7 directly from over 100 global farms through our unique platform. By eliminating the middleman, we ensure that our flowers are not only farm-fresh but also competitively priced. As a scale-up, iBuyflowers operates globally with clients in the US, a dedicated IT team in Colombia, and an E-commerce team from The Netherlands.
